I had an Asus router, the 66N handling all my multicast and IPTV duties, until it died. Now I'm back to the Telus router. It works. It's not the best, but now that I'm back on disability, a new router isn't in the cards right now.
What I want to do, is plug in a HDD formatted to FAT32, which the router seems to recognize in the control panel, and stream my FLAC files to my Marantz receiver. When you plug in a freshly formatted drive, it writes two folders on it "admin" and "share". I've tried putting files in these folders, and for some reason, they are not seen. So, I tried using the menu structure of my Marantz receiver, "Music","All Music" and putting a folder of music in there. I'm wondering if this is even worth it, as I'm not sure Telus has activated the USB port on the last firmware update.
Anyone know, or have experience in trying to set this up?
